c++连接MySQL有两种方式,1是原始的方法,2是用 Connector c++ 。Connector c++ 只是一种封装,使之更加方便。1、原始方法这里归纳了C API可使用的函数,并在下一节详细介绍了它们。 函数描述mysql_affected_rows()返回上次UPDATE、DELETE或INSERT查询更改/删除/插入的行数。mysql_autocommit
转载
2023-07-18 23:02:17
93阅读
**C语言中函数参数传递的方式:值传递,地址传递**值传递:将实参的值复制至形参的相应存储单元中,实参与形参占用不同存储单元,单向传递
地址传递:使用数组名或者指针作为函数参数,传递的是该数组的首地址或指针的值,而形参接收到的是地址,
即指向实参的存储单元,形参和实参占用相同的存储单元
引用传递:C++中主要内容:
1> c语言中地址传递实参的方法
2> 多函数嵌套传递实参
转载
2023-07-18 16:30:11
62阅读
# 实现mysql c库函数
## 流程图
```mermaid
flowchart TD
A[了解mysql c库] --> B[连接到mysql服务器]
B --> C[执行SQL语句]
C --> D[处理查询结果]
D --> E[关闭连接]
```
## 步骤详解
### 了解mysql c库
在开始使用mysql c库函数之前,我们首先需要了解
原创
2023-10-06 03:36:28
51阅读
# **MySQL C 相关函数科普**
在进行 C 语言编程中,经常会遇到需要和 MySQL 数据库进行交互的情况。为了方便在 C 语言程序中操作 MySQL 数据库,MySQL 提供了一系列的 C API 函数供开发者使用。本文将介绍一些常用的 MySQL C 相关函数,并给出相应的代码示例。
## **MySQL C API 函数**
MySQL C API 提供了一系列函数,可以用来
原创
2024-05-08 05:39:48
35阅读
一、打开文件 打开文件使用库函数中的fopen函数。fopen函数会为要打开的文件新建一个流,然后返回一个指向file型对象的指针,该file型对象中保存了控制这个流所需要的信息。 fp=fopen("1.txt","r")这里fp可以任意命名,fp不是流的实体,而是指向流的指针。接收两个参数,一个是文件名,另一个是打开文件的模式。 打开文件的mode模式有: Mode描述r以只读模式打开文件w以
转载
2023-07-21 21:07:48
28阅读
今天我们主要MySQL的函数和谓词。 目录1.函数1.1算数函数1.2 字符串函数1.3 日期函数1.4 转换函数2.谓词参考资料 1.函数我们在前面几张章学习了SQL语言一些基本的语法结构,今天我们来介绍函数,函数大致可以分为以下几种:算数函数(用来进行数值计算的函数)字符串函数(用来进行字符串操作的函数)日期函数(用来进行日期操作的函数转换函数(用来转化数据类型和值的函数)聚合函数(用来进行数
转载
2023-09-06 22:32:41
42阅读
什么是Mysql函数:类似于java的方法将一组逻辑语句封装在方法体 对外暴露方法名 事先提供好的一些功能可以直接使用 函数可以用在select 语句及其子句上 也可以用在update ,delete 语句当中函数分类:1)字符串函数 2)数值函数 3) 日期和时间函数 4) 流程函数 5) 聚合 函数 6) 自定义函数 7) 其他函数字符串函数:concat(s1,s2…sn):将传入的字符串连
转载
2023-08-31 21:22:19
32阅读
在Excel函数中,大家最熟悉的莫过于SUM函数了。 SUM函数,一个非常简单而且常用的函数,很多人对它的理解仅局限于用“∑”按钮自动求和的功能,例如:SUM函数大家用得最多的,可能就是=SUM(A1:A200),这就是常见的自动求和给出的类似公式。但SUM函数,你真的足够了解它吗?请不要小看它哦,它的实力不可小觑。它不仅仅只局限于简单的自动求和。今天就让我们一起来探讨一下SUM函数的其它妙用,让
转载
2023-07-04 10:36:52
338阅读
MySQL数据库中提供了很丰富的函数。MySQL函数包括数学函数、字符串函数、日期和时间函数、条件判断函数、系统信息函数、加密函数、格式化函数等。通过这些函数,可以简化用户的操作。例如,字符串连接函数可以很方便的将多个字符串连接在一起。在这一讲中将讲解的内容包括:数学函数 字符串函数 日期和时间函数 条件判断函数 系统信息函数 加密函数 格式化函数 &nb
转载
2023-05-24 10:50:12
52阅读
今天下午闲着没事干,组长让我熟悉下C++连接数据库,并对其进行操作,整个过程还算顺利,为了记忆和下次使用,现把整个过程记录下来:1.安装mysql略2.建立C++控制台程序,新建CPP源文件,如:sqlconn.cpp3.在工程项目中属性->c/C++->常规->附加包含目录中添加mysql安装目录中的MySQL\MySQL\MySQL Server 5.7\include&nb
转载
2023-06-27 15:39:50
69阅读
Mysql 按年、季度、月分组
按月度分组:
select DATE_FORMAT(i.created_at, '%Y-%m月')...................GROUP BY DATE_FORMAT(i.created_at, '%Y-%m')
按季度分组:
select CONCAT(YEAR(i.created_at),'_',QUARTER(i.created_at),'Q').
所有的 C++ 程序都有以下两个基本要素: 程序语句(代码):这是程序中执行动作的部分,它们被称为函数。程序数据:数据是程序的信息,会受到程序函数的影响。封装是面向对象编程中的把数据和操作数据的函数绑定在一起的一个概念,这样能避免受到外界的干扰和误用,从而确保了安全。数据封装引申出了另一个重要的 OOP 概念,即数据隐藏。数据封装是一种把数据和操作数据的函数捆绑在一起的机制,数据抽象是一种仅向用户
转载
2023-10-05 21:27:43
64阅读
一,函数的定义一般来说,执行源程序就是执行主函数main,其他函数只能被主函数所调用,而其他函数之间也可以相互调用。1.标准库函数:分为:I/O函数,字符串,字符处理函数,数学函数,接口函数,时间转换和操作函数,动态地址分配函数,目录函数,过程控制函数,字符屏幕和图形功能函数。这些库函数在不同的头文件中声明。比如:math.h头文件中有:sin(x),cos(x),exp(x)(求e^x),fab
转载
2023-09-01 23:07:29
79阅读
# 连接 MySQL 数据库的 C 语言函数实现教程
## 简介
在 C 语言中连接 MySQL 数据库是一个常见的需求,本文将教会你如何使用 C 语言实现连接 MySQL 数据库的函数。
## 步骤概览
以下是连接 MySQL 数据库的函数实现流程:
```mermaid
pie
title 步骤概览
"创建连接" : 1
"初始化连接" : 2
"选择数据
原创
2024-05-21 05:45:28
15阅读
在C连接mysql服务器,需要使用libmysqlclient开发包。在ubuntu系统上可以通过
命令 sudo apt-get install libsqlclient-dev 安装。
和其它和数据库访问类似,具体的过程有
1,连接数据库
2,访问数据
3,处理数据
4,断开连接
下面,接上面的顺序来了解mysql数据库编程所要用到的具体函数
一,连接数据库
1,初始化一个连
原创
2010-10-28 23:16:07
1302阅读
这节主要是介绍MySQL的api函数,使用这些api函数可以完成C语言操作MySQL数据库。初始化连接环境//参数 mysql为null
//返回值:用于连接MySQL服务器
MYSQL* mysql_init(MYSQL* mysql);连接MySQL服务器//返回值与第一个参数类型相同
MYSQL* mysql_real_connect(
MYSQL* mysql, // mysql_ini
转载
2023-11-02 10:18:42
45阅读
文章目录数学函数` abs(X)` 返回X的绝对值`mod(N,M)` 或 `%` 返回 N 被 M 除的余数`floor(X)` 返回不大于X的最大整数值。`ceiling(X)` 返回不小于X的最小整数值。`round(X)` 返回参数X的四舍五入的一个整数。字符串函数`ascii(str)` 返回字符串str的最左面字符的ASCII代码值。如果str是空字符串,返回0。如果str是NULL
转载
2023-05-23 12:41:32
39阅读
MySQL的存储过程(stored procedure)和函数(stored function)统称为stored routines。它是事先经过编译并存储在数据库中的一段SQL语句的集合。存储过程与函数的区别本质上没区别。函数只能通过return语句返回单个值或者表对象。而存储过程不允许执行return,但是通过out参数返回多个值。函数是可以嵌入在sql中使用的,可以在select中调用,而存
转载
2023-08-10 15:52:24
48阅读
MySQL存储函数(自定义函数),函数一般用于计算和返回一个值,可以将经常需要使用的计算或功能写成一个函数1、创建存储函数:使用 create function关键字 2、调用存储函数: 3、示例:无参有返回值: 作用:统计worker表中的员工个数: 有参返回值: 作用:根据id返回学生名字 inout_id:参数名称 name
转载
2023-05-30 13:46:36
49阅读
对于每个类型拥有的值范围以及并且指定日期何时间值的有效格式的描述见7.3.6 日期和时间类型。 这里是一个使用日期函数的例子。下面的查询选择了所有记录,其date_col的值是在最后30天以内: mysql> select something from table where to_days(no
转载
2023-09-07 15:27:29
71阅读